Featured Peak: Mount Elbert

Mount Elbert

At 14,439 feet, Mount Elbert stands as the highest peak in Colorado and the second-highest in the contiguous United States. It's a popular, yet challenging, climb offering breathtaking panoramic views of the Sawatch Range.

Hiking Details:

  • Elevation: 14,439 ft (4,401 m)
  • Range: Sawatch Range
  • Difficulty: Class 1 (Moderate)
  • Popular Route: Northeast Ridge
  • Best Time to Climb: July to September
